壳聚糖固定化酵母蔗糖酶的研究
Study on the Properties of Chitsan-immoblized Yeast Sucrase
【摘要】 用壳聚糖作吸附剂、戊二醛作交联剂,对酵母蔗糖酶进行固定化研究,同时用琼脂糖固定化的蔗糖酶和游离酶与其进行比较。结果表明,壳聚糖固定化蔗糖酶贮藏稳定性、对变性剂以及对温度的耐受性均明显优越,而Km值与琼脂糖固定化酶相当,但比游离酶明显增高,酶的最适pH三者相近。研究表明,壳聚糖固定化酶所需的戊二醛浓度为0.6%,交联时间不低于6 h。固定化蔗糖酶对变性剂(乙醇、脲)的耐受力明显高于游离酶。
【Abstract】 Yeast sucrase immobilized to chitosan with glutaric dialdehyde as cross-linking agent was studied,while agrose-immobilized and free enzymes were as control.The results showed the stability of chitosan-immobilized enzyme increased much more than that of agarose-immobilized enzyme or free enzyme.The Michaelis-Menten Kinetics of chitosan-immobilized enzyme was equal to that of agarose-immobilized enzyme,but much higher than that of free enzyme.The optimum pH of these enzymes was almost the same.In preparation chitosan-immobilized enzyme,0.6% glutaric dialdehyde and more than 6 hr crosslinking were required.To free enzyme,chitosan-immobilized enzyme was more stable in ancohol or urea.
